Self-study Free Resources

Khan Academy
From k12 to college freshmen level math. Lots of videos and practice questions.

CliffsNotes
Has study guides for basic math to linear algebra and differential equations. Brief and quick guide for concepts.

Wolfram Math World
Concepts from many different fields, tools, interactive demos. 

Art of Problem Solving
Known for all the resources for math competitions on their wiki page. However, there are more hidden gems to be explored here.

AMS Open Notes
Open math lecture notes on all math topics from universities.

The Princeton Companion to Mathematics
A Wikipedia for math. Not necessarily understandable, but always good to have a reference.

Pi in the Sky Magazine
"Primarily aimed at high-school students and teachers, with the main goal of providing a cultural context/landscape for mathematics."

Mathtube
Mathematical seminar and lecture materials, including videos, notes, and slides.

Terence Tao's blog
"Updates on my research and expository papers, discussion of open problems, and other maths-related topics."

Tim Gowers' blog

Math StackExchange
Great place to check out when having questions.
